数据分析----Pandas

数据分析----Pandas

 Pandas常用的数据类型:

1.Series 一维,带标签数组

2.DataFrame 二维,Series容器

import pandas as pd

t=pd.Series([1,2,3,45,6,3,8]) 

print(t)

数据分析----Pandas

指定索引:

t=pd.Series([1,2,3,45,6,3,8],index=list("abcdefg")) 

print(t)

数据分析----Pandas

pandasSeries创建

a=pd.Series({"name":"xiaoming","age":"30","tel":"10086"})

print(a)

数据分析----Pandas

其中索引就是字典中的键:"name","age","tel"

数据分析----Pandas

pandasSeries切片和索引

数据分析----Pandas

pandasSeries的索引和值

.index表示得出索引,.values表示得出值

数据分析----Pandas

数据分析----Pandas

pandasDataFrame

数据分析----Pandas

其中,index表示行的索引,columns表示列的索引

Series能够传入字典,那么DataFrame能够传入字典作为数据么数据分析----Pandas

sort_values(by=(以哪一列),ascending=False(降序))

数据分析----Pandas

pandasloc

1.df.loc 通过标签引行数据

数据分析----Pandas

小例子

数据分析----Pandas

数据分析----Pandas

数据分析----Pandas

数据分析----Pandas

数据分析----Pandas

2 df.iloc 通过位置获取行数据

数据分析----Pandas

数据分析----Pandas